If anyone has any objections, please let me know. ------------------ From: Ricardo Ribalda commit c9ec6f1736363b2b2bb4e266997389740f628441 upstream. uvc_unregister_video() can be called asynchronously from uvc_disconnect(). If the device is still streaming when that happens, a plethora of race conditions can occur. Make sure that the device has stopped streaming before exiting this function. If the user still holds handles to the driver's file descriptors, any ioctl will return -ENODEV from the v4l2 core. This change makes uvc more consistent with the rest of the v4l2 drivers using the vb2_fop_* and vb2_ioctl_* helpers. This driver (and many other usb drivers) always had this problem, but it wasn't possible to easily fix this until the vb2_video_unregister_device() helper was added. So the Fixes tag points to the creation of that helper.
